Connor Herson climbing 'Drifters Escape' (5.15a/9a+) at Squamish, Canada
Watch Connor Herson free Drifter’s Escape, 9a+ trad at Squamish
The video of American climber Connor Herson establishing 'Drifter’s Escape' at Squamish in Canada. Graded 9a+, this is as the world's first trad climb of this difficulty.
After two seasons and roughly 20 attempts, on 14 July 2025 Connor Herson completed the first ascent of Drifter’s Escape on Stawamus Chief in Squamish. He proposed a grade of 9a+ (5.15a), making it a contender for the world’s hardest trad route.
